什么是二进制数
发布时间:2026-01-05 08:50:11来源:
【什么是二进制数】在计算机科学和数字系统中,二进制数是一种基于2的计数系统,它使用两个数字“0”和“1”来表示所有的数值。与我们日常使用的十进制数(基于10)不同,二进制数只包含两个基本符号,这使得它非常适合用于电子设备中的信息存储和处理。
二进制数广泛应用于计算机硬件、编程语言、数据传输等领域。理解二进制数的基本概念和转换方法,有助于更好地掌握计算机的工作原理。
一、二进制数的定义
| 概念 | 定义 |
| 二进制数 | 由0和1组成的数制系统,每一位代表一个2的幂次。 |
| 基数 | 2,即每一位的权重是2的幂次。 |
| 位 | 每个数字称为一个“位”(bit),是信息的最小单位。 |
二、二进制数的特点
| 特点 | 说明 |
| 简单性 | 只有0和1两种状态,便于电子电路实现。 |
| 逻辑性 | 与布尔逻辑(真/假)高度契合。 |
| 通用性 | 所有数字和字符都可以用二进制表示。 |
| 有限性 | 每一位只能表示两种状态,因此需要更多位数来表示大数值。 |
三、二进制与十进制的转换
| 二进制数 | 对应的十进制值 | 计算方式 |
| 101 | 5 | 1×2² + 0×2¹ + 1×2⁰ = 4 + 0 + 1 = 5 |
| 1101 | 13 | 1×2³ + 1×2² + 0×2¹ + 1×2⁰ = 8 + 4 + 0 + 1 = 13 |
| 10010 | 18 | 1×2⁴ + 0×2³ + 0×2² + 1×2¹ + 0×2⁰ = 16 + 0 + 0 + 2 + 0 = 18 |
四、二进制的应用
| 应用领域 | 说明 |
| 计算机内部 | 所有数据和指令都以二进制形式存储和处理。 |
| 编程语言 | 高级语言最终会被编译成二进制代码。 |
| 数据通信 | 信息通过二进制信号传输,如网络和无线通信。 |
| 存储设备 | 硬盘、内存等存储介质以二进制形式保存数据。 |
五、总结
二进制数是现代数字系统的核心,它以最简的方式表达了所有信息。虽然它的表达方式看似复杂,但通过学习其规则和转换方法,可以轻松理解和应用。无论是对计算机科学的学习者,还是对信息技术感兴趣的用户,掌握二进制知识都是必不可少的一步。
关键词: 二进制数、十进制、位、计算机、数据存储、转换方法
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。
